The Ontario Bar Association’s Entertainment, Media and Communications Law Section is hosting the 2012 edition of its Half-Day Conference on Tuesday, October 2, 2012, with the program running from noon until 5pm. Featuring a keynote address from Bernie Finkelstein (Founder of True North Records), and panels offering updates on the Supreme Court of Canada’s Copyright Pentalogy decisions, a primer on music licensing in the digital era and a round-table discussion on cultivating the in-house/external counsel relationship, the conference promises to be a resounding way to kick off the programming year for the EM&C Section.
